Formal partial takeover offer of Airwork could be tabled by next week

By Edwin Mitson Oct. 26 (BusinessDesk) - Airwork Holdings, the Auckland-based aircraft services business, has told investors a formal partial takeover offer could be made as early as next week, provided conditions are satisfied or waived.  Earlier this month Chinese company Zhejiang Rifa Holding Group (RIFA) announced it had entered a takeover lock-up deed with the major shareholders at $5.40 per share.
